Abstract: Objective To conduct a quantitative analysis of the related literature on the prevention and treatment of acquired immunodeficiency syndrome(AIDS) with traditional Chinese medicine in China,so as to understand the research status and development trend in this field. Methods Chinese journals on traditional Chinese medicine in the treatment of AIDS from January 2013 to December 2022 were searched in China National Knowledge Infrastructure,Wanfang Database,VIP database and China Biology Medicine Disc,and the number of published papers,authors,institutions and keywords were analyzed and presented in the way of atlas. Results A total of 770 valid documents were included,with the highest number of publications in 2013 reaching 129,followed by fluctuations and a decreasing trend in the number of publications thereafter.The top three authors in terms of publication volume were XU Liran(118 papers),GUO Huijun(102 papers),and XU Qianlei(68 papers).Research institutions were mainly provincial traditional Chinese medicine universities and affiliated hospitals,with the institution with the highest publication volume being the First Affiliated Hospital of Henan University of Chinese Medicine,accounting for 28.96%(223/770) of the total publications,making it a core institution in this field of research.Co-occurrence and clustering analysis of keywords showed that from January 2013 to December 2022,research in this field focused on the construction and application promotion of the traditional Chinese medicine pattern differentiation treatment and efficacy evaluation system.Keyword emergence and timeline analysis indicated that collaborative treatment had emerged as a new hot topic in this field in recent years. Conclusion This field has formed a relatively stable research team and collaborative network,with research showing continuity and systematicity,aligning with the development model of evidence-based medicine.Collaborative treatment,as a current emerging hot topic,is predicted to become a new research focus and trend in studies related to collaborative treatment drugs.
